Marshallese vs Guamanian/Chamorro Disability Age 18 to 34 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 14,758,434 people shows a poor positive correlation between the proportion of Marshallese and percentage of population with a disability between the ages 18 and 35 in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.157 and weighted average of 7.1%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 221,642,972 people shows a moderate positive correlation between the proportion of Guamanians/Chamorros and percentage of population with a disability between the ages 18 and 35 in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.459 and weighted average of 7.2%, a difference of 0.86%.
